Provincial government underscores protection of “Boracay of the North”

              Vice Governor Barba

PAGUDPUD, ILOCOS NORTE (PIA) — The provincial government was taking increment measures in ensuring the protection of the beaches in Pagudpud dubbed as “Boracay of the North,” officials said.

Vice Governor Angelo Marcos Barba sought the cooperation of the locals in Pagudpud through the efforts of DENR and the provincial government in keeping Pagudpud from falling into the same fate as Boracay in Malay, Aklan.

Resort and business owners in the said town are reminded to observe proper waste disposal and avoidance of pollution-causing objects to maintain the cleanliness in the surrounding beaches such as in Saud, Balaoi, and nearby barangays.

During the recent Holy Week observance, the town tallied over 500,000 tourists, which make Pagudpud one of the most sought-after tourist destinations in the province.

If appropriately sustained, Pagudpud will continue to attract tourist and increase tourist arrivals in the region. (Ma. Joreina Therese A. Blanco/PIA1-ILOCOS NORTE)
